What companies run services between Govan, Scotland and Loch Lomond, Argyll and Bute, Scotland?

ScotRail operates a train from Partick to Balloch hourly. Tickets cost £7–8 and the journey takes 42 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Auchentorlie Street to Balloch Bus Terminus via Duchall Street and Asda St James Retail Park in around 1h 42m.
